Leandra’s Law Arrest After Car Crash

leandra's law arrest lake grove

A car crash that took place yesterday evening, on Route 25 and Moriches Road in Lake Grove has resulted in a Leandra’s Law arrest.  On Sunday, February 28th, at approximately 5:40 p.m. Suffolk County Police arrested Ronkonkoma resident, Rashelle Man for driving under the influence with her child in the car, following a crash.

The collision took place when Mann, who was heading eastbound on Route 25 in her 2006 Nissan Altima, turned left, in front of a 2014 Toyota Rav4, which was heading west.

Her 2 year old son was in the vehicle at the time. The boy was transported to Stony Brook University Medical Center by a Nesconset Fire Department ambulance, for evaluation.  After being examined, Mann’s son was discharged and released to a family member. Hauppauge resident Cindy Tran, the driver of the Toyota, was also taken to Stony Brook University Hospital. She was treated for minor injuries.

Mann, 26, of Ronkonkoma, was charged with Aggravated Driving While Intoxicated with a Child Passenger 15 Years Old or Younger (Leandra’s Law), Driving While Intoxicated, Aggravated Unlicensed Operation of a Motor Vehicle and Endangering the Welfare of a Child.  She is scheduled to be arraigned today at First District Court in Central Islip.

The vehicle was impounded for a safety check and the investigation is continuing. Detectives are asking anyone with information about this crash to call the Fourth Squad at631-854-8452.

Suffolk County Police officials remind the public that a criminal charge is an accusation and that a defendant is presumed innocent until and unless proven guilty.
